Concrete raising services involve restoring the levelness of sunken or uneven concrete slabs through specialized techniques. Typically, this process uses materials like foam or mudjacking to lift and stabilize the existing concrete, eliminating the need for complete replacement. The procedure is designed to be minimally invasive, allowing for a quicker turnaround compared to traditional methods of removal and replacement. By addressing the underlying causes of sinking or settling, concrete raising helps to restore the original grade and surface evenness of the affected area.
This service is particularly effective in resolving issues caused by soil erosion, poor compaction, or underground voids that lead to uneven or cracked concrete surfaces. Common problems include trip hazards, water pooling, and structural instability, which can pose safety risks and diminish property value. Concrete raising provides a practical solution to these issues by leveling the surface, reducing the risk of accidents, and improving the overall appearance of walkways, driveways, patios, and other concrete features.

Cost Range - Concrete raising services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 per slab, depending on size and extent of damage. Larger or more complex projects may reach up to $2,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Price - The total cost can vary based on the number of slabs needing repair and accessibility. For example, a small driveway section might be closer to $500, while a large patio could be around $1,800.
Average Cost Factors - Most homeowners in Vandalia, OH, see prices fall within the $700 to $1,200 range for standard residential concrete raising. Additional costs may apply for extensive or uneven settlement issues.

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that lifts and levels sunken or uneven concrete slabs, restoring their original position and appearance.
How do professionals raise concrete slabs? Local service providers typically use foam or mudjacking techniques to lift and stabilize the concrete.
What are the benefits of concrete raising? Concrete raising can improve safety, enhance curb appeal, and avoid the cost of replacing the slab.
Is concrete raising suitable for all types of concrete damage? It is most effective for sunken or uneven slabs caused by soil settlement or erosion, but may not be suitable for large cracks or extensive damage.
